ホームページ >バックエンド開発 >Python チュートリアル >Python で月の最終日を効率的に判断するにはどうすればよいですか?
Python で月の最後の日を決定する
特定の月の最後の日を見つけるための効率的で簡単なアプローチを求めている開発者向けPython の標準ライブラリ、calendar.monthrange を使用すると役に立ちます。この関数は、月の最初の日の曜日とその月の日数という 2 つの要素を含む配列を返します。
import calendar # Get last day of January 2002 last_day_of_jan_2002 = calendar.monthrange(2002, 1)[1] # Result: 31
以下の例に示すように、うるう年の処理もシームレスです。
# Get last day of February 2008 (leap year) last_day_of_feb_2008 = calendar.monthrange(2008, 2)[1] # Result: 29
簡潔な表現が必要な場合は、次のコード スニペットを使用できます:
calendar.monthrange(year, month)[1]
以上がPython で月の最終日を効率的に判断する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。